Abstract
The bachlor thesis is aimed to the design and strength control of approaching ramp for helicopter. The first part is dedicated to the current state and the chapter also describes entry conditions. The following chapter consists of primary design of steel structures numerically by finite element method (FEM) and also analytically. Numerical solution is performed in the software ANSYS Workbench 18.2 and beam elements are used. A simplified analytical solution is applied only on one segment of approaching ramp. Last chapter is focused on an optimlization two segments of approaching ramp and their strength control.
